Transaction 173fd9107582e4475c14b3359208b32ecca48f89d3bd29cdb8d2884004004a91
1 Input
1 Output
-
173fd9107582e4475c14b3359208b32ecca48f89d3bd29cdb8d2884004004a91:0
- value
- 43502
- script pubkey
- OP_0 OP_PUSHBYTES_20 7d67c701f77f63abdf1678153e63fd256167bca5
- address
- bc1q04nuwq0h0a36hhck0q2nuclay4sk0099n4h3du